Lile takes lead in Nationwide Tour event

By The Associated Press
Posted 8:50AM on Friday 21st April 2006 ( 19 years ago )
<p>South Africa's Craig Lile shot a bogey-free 8-under 64 on Friday to take a one-stroke lead over playing partner Zoran Zorkic after the second round of the Nationwide Tour's inaugural Athens Regional Foundation Classic.</p><p>Lile, a former Arkansas star who is winless in four seasons on the developmental tour, had a 15-under 129 total on the Jennings Mill course.</p><p>"We had a great time out there today," said Lile, who also played with Boo Weekley. "It was a great group. Boo and Zoran are great guys to play with.</p><p>"For me, the key has been my consistency. I don't think there is one thing that stands out. I putted well, hit my irons well and drove it well."</p><p>Zorkic also shot a 64.</p><p>"If you had to pick two guys to play with, then you'd pick Boo and Craig," Zorkic said. "We talked about everything but golf today. We had some good mojo going."</p><p>Paul Gow (67) was two strokes back at 13 under, and first-round leader Ken Duke (69) was another stroke behind. Weekley was 4 under after a 69.</p><p>Tripp Isenhour, a victory short of earning an immediate promotion to the PGA Tour as a three-time winner in a season, missed the cut with rounds of 72 and 74.</p><p>The winner will receive $90,000 from the $500,000 purse.</p>
